Chicken Alfredo Monkey Bread

This Chicken Alfredo Monkey Bread is a cheesy, savory pull-apart recipe made with pizza dough, rotisserie chicken, and creamy Alfredo sauce. It is a cozy, shareable dish perfect for family dinners, parties, and memory-making in the kitchen.

Ingredients

  • 2 tubes refrigerated pizza dough cut into 1 to 2 inch pieces
  • 2 cups rotisserie chicken cooked and shredded
  • 1.5 cups Alfredo sauce divided
  • 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ese divided
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ese divided
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 0.5 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 0.25 cup unsalted butter melted
  • 2 tablespoon fresh parsley chopped, for garnish

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and generously grease a bundt pan.
  • In a large bowl, mix the shredded chicken, 1 cup Alfredo sauce, 1 cup mozzarella cheese, half of the Parmesan cheese, Italian seasoning, and garlic powder.
  • Unroll the pizza dough and cut it into bite-sized pieces.
  • Place one-third of the dough pieces into the bundt pan. Top with half of the chicken mixture and sprinkle with mozzarella cheese.
  • Repeat the layers with remaining dough and chicken mixture. Brush the top with melted butter and sprinkle with remaining Parmesan cheese.
  • Bake for 35–40 minutes until golden and bubbling. If browning too quickly, loosely cover with foil.
  • Cool for 5 minutes, invert onto a serving plate, drizzle with remaining Alfredo sauce, garnish with parsley, and serve warm.

Notes

This recipe is very forgiving and perfect for cooking with kids.
You can swap pizza dough for biscuit dough for a softer texture.
Leftovers reheat beautifully in the oven or air fryer.
This monkey bread is wonderful as a dinner centerpiece or a party appetizer.
